Rockefeller Capital Management was established in 2018 as a leading independent financial advisory services firm. Originally founded in 1882 as the family office of John D.

Rockefeller, the Firm has evolved to offer strategic advice to ultra- and high-net-worth individuals and families, institutions, and corporations from offices in 30 markets throughout the United States, as well as an office in London.

The Firm oversees $133 billion in client assets as of March 31, 2024.

Position

The Compliance Officer will be responsible for the review of communications, including marketing materials, monthly reports and commentaries, factsheets, brochures, presentations, videos, podcasts, websites, requests for proposals, due diligence questionnaires, and other materials for compliance with regulatory requirements (SEC Marketing Rule, FINRA 2210, Investment Company Act of 1940 and other rules and regulations) and the firm’s internal policies.

The candidate must have strong communication skills and the ability to deliver accurate and clear guidance to business partners.

The candidate must have an understanding of marketing rules related to private funds (hedge funds, private equity funds, private credit funds).

Responsibilities

  • Coordinate with various departments and supervisory principals in order to provide timely responses.
  • Draft disclosures and maintain the firm’s disclosure library.
  • Develop and update marketing compliance policies and procedures in response to changes in regulations and business needs.
  • Conduct periodic training on the various marketing and advertising rules.
  • Develop and maintain a comprehensive understanding of relevant regulations, industry standards, and internal policies affecting marketing activities.
  • Analyze cross-border issues for the asset management division and scope the impact of regulatory developments.
  • Provide training and guidance to marketing teams on compliance requirements, best practices, and internal processes.
  • Work closely with marketing, legal, sales, and other departments to ensure cohesive and compliant marketing strategies.

Qualifications

  • 5-7 years relevant experience.
  • Bachelor's degree.
  • Previous experience working in Marketing Compliance.
  • Demonstrated compliance, supervision or legal experience with a broker-dealer or registered investment advisor required;

knowledge of complex products is a plus.

  • Knowledge of the securities industry, from an investment product / service and compliance perspective.
  • Deadline-oriented with the ability to analyze matters appropriately.
  • Working knowledge and experience of FINRA rules and regulations, Investment Advisers Act of 1940, Investment Company Act of 1940.

Compensation Range

The anticipated base salary range for this role is $140,000 to $150,000. Base salary for the role will depend on several factors, including a candidate’s qualifications, skills, competencies, and experience, and may fall outside of the range shown.

In addition, this role may be eligible for a discretionary bonus. Rockefeller Capital Management offers a comprehensive benefits package including health coverage, vacation time, paid leave, retirement plan, and more.
